اطلاعیه

Collapse
No announcement yet.

مدار گیرنده ریموت کد لرن

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    مدار گیرنده ریموت کد لرن

    از بس دنبال مدار گیرنده کد لرن و تکنیک کار اون گشتم وپیدا نکردم دیگه خسته شدم . نمیدونم چرا خودمون رو با این کد فیکس سر کار گذاشتیم . بیاین یکم از داشته هامون رو با همدیگه قسمت کنیم ، تو هر سایتی میرم همه انگار دارن اطلاعات همو کپی میکنن. تنها یک نفر پروژه آماده اونو داره که میفروشه . من دنبال آماده نیستم . میخام یاد بگیرم . حالا دوستان یک زحمت بکشن این بحثو کامل کنیم که هم یاد بگیریم و هم یاد بدیم .

    #2
    پاسخ : مدار گیرنده ریموت کد لرن

    سلام
    اگه منظورت رو درست فهمیده باشم مداری رو که شما میگی من با ماژولهای RFM01 و 02 ساختم اگه بدرد کارت میخوره خوشحال میشم کمک کنم

    دیدگاه


      #3
      پاسخ : مدار گیرنده ریموت کد لرن

      با تشکر از دوست عزیز . راستش ایده این کار اولین بار از اونجا به ذهنم رسید که برای یکی از دوستان یک مدار درب بازکن با استفاده از ریموت های کد لرن نصب کرده بودن . برای اون مجتمع 20 واحدی 20 عدد ریموت رو لرن کرده بودن و خیلی راحت همه ازش استفاده میکردن . مدارش رو دیدم که یک مازول گیرنده ask آ‌بود با یک میکرو pic . حالا میخوام اگه بشه اونو بسازم . من تازه کار با میکرو رو شروع کردم و خیلی بهش علاقه مند شدم . احساس میکنم که یک دریچه تازه واسم باز شده ولی هر چی گشتم نتونستن یک مرجع خوب پیدا کنم که بتونم این مشکل رو حلش کنم . نمیدونم سیستم کد گذاریش چیه ! بعضی ها میگن از usart استفاده کرده و بعضی میگن از منچستر . حالا میخوام بدونم دقیقاً چه جوری میشه اطلاعات رو دیکود کرد که برای اضافه کردن یک ریموت لازم نباشه مثل کد فیکس ها مدار رو باز کرد و لحیم کاری کرد و امنیتش هم بالا باشه چون اونطور که شنیدم کد لرن تا یک میلیون کد میسازه

      دیدگاه


        #4
        پاسخ : مدار گیرنده ریموت کد لرن


        خواهش میکنم :smile:
        قسمت اول کارمون که سخت افزار اونه رو باید از ماژولهای RF استفاده کنی من از ماژولهای RFM01 و RFM02 که یکیش گیرنده و دومی فرستندست استفاده کردم برا قسمت ریموت چون باید مدارمون کوچیک در بیاد که تو فریم ریموت جا بشه از Tiny45 که 8 پینه میشه برا راه اندازی ماژول rfm02 استفاده کرد
        قسمت گیرنده هم که چیز خاصی احتیاج نداره و مثلا یه Mega48 خوراک راه اندازی ماژول RFM01 هستش


        و اما نرم افزارش هم اصلا نگران کننده نیست و مطلقا نیاز به منچستر و چلسی و لیورپول نداره! :mrgreen:

        اصل قضیه اینه که شما یه پروتکل دلخواه برا دیتایی که ریموت واسه گیرنده میفرسته در نظر میگیری
        مثلا ریموت 4 بایت + یه بایت Chksum رو به گیرنده میفرسته این چهار بایت برا هر ریموت منحصر به فرده
        یعنی شما موقع پروگرام کردن هر ریموت این کد 4 بایتی رو بهش میدی
        و اما گیرنده:
        از لحاظ سخت افزاری شما روی برد گیرنده باید یه میکروسوییچ بذاری حالا اگه یه کد از طرف یکی از ریموت ها برا گیرنده ارسال بشه بعد از بررسی صحت کد اگه میکرو سوییچ فشار داده شده باشه کد دریافتی از ریموت رو تو ایپرام داخلی خودش نگه میداره و اگه کلید آزاد باشه گیرنه ایپرام خودش رو به دنبال کد دریافتی از ریموت بررسی میکنه اگه کد موجود بود رله رو وصل میکنه

        بهمین سادگی شما با توجه به ظرفیت ایپرام میکروی گیرنده و بایتهای تشکیل دهنده کد ریموت میتونی کلی ریموت رو به سادگی برا گیرنده تعریف کنی

        ضمنا در این مورد با توجه به چهار بایت بودن کد ارسالی به تعداد 2 به توان 32 عدد ریموت با کدهای منحصر به فرد میتونی داشته باشی

        دیدگاه


          #5
          پاسخ : مدار گیرنده ریموت کد لرن

          با تشکر از این مهندس عزیز که اینقدر زود پاسخ دادند . باید خدمتتون عرض کنم که اگه من بخوام از ریموت های داخل بازار استفاده کنم که هزینه هم کمتر در بیاد باید چکار کنم . چون همونطور که شما فرمودید اگه بخام واسه فرستنده از یک tiny45 استفاده کنم اونوقت فرستنده من باید کاملاً دستساز باشه که اون ظاهر زیبا رو نداره و مثل ریموت های داخل بازار نمیشه .

          دیدگاه


            #6
            پاسخ : مدار گیرنده ریموت کد لرن


            سلام چرا فکر میکنید مثل نمونه های بازار نمیشه !؟
            مطمئن باشین کاملا انجام پذیره RFM02 + Tiny45 + Battry همشون براحتی تو قاب ریموت جا میشن

            دیدگاه


              #7
              پاسخ : مدار گیرنده ریموت کد لرن

              مهندس جان آخه این خیلی گرون میش2900 تومان tiny45 بعلاوه 3800 تومان rfm بعلاوه باتری و قاب و از این حرفها کلی میشه در حالی که شما اگه یه ریموت لرن خوب مثل بتا بخرید قیمتش تنها 4500 تومان میشه . چون من میخام واسه واحد خودمون هم درست کنم و روی تعداد 15 واحد خیلی تفاوت میکنه .

              دیدگاه


                #8
                پاسخ : مدار گیرنده ریموت کد لرن

                در این مورد به شما حق میدم از لحاظ قیمت گرونتر در میاد و مسلما نمونه های این نوع ریموت که تو کشور دوست و برادر چین تولید میشه رو میشه به قیمت خیلی پایین تر خریداری کرد

                البته اگه به عنوان یه تجربه جدید بهش نگاه کنی احتمالا ارزش هزینه کردن رو داره چون صد در صد عملیه

                ولی اینکه شما بخوای از ریموتهای بازار استفاده کنی دو تا مشکل پیش میاد اول اینکه باید یه ماژول گیرنده پیدا کنی که قادر به دریافت کد ریموت باشه (یا اینکه گیرنده رو از رو نمونه خارجیش بسازی!) و دوم دیکد کردن دیتای دریافتی که مورد دوم اون کار سختی نیست ولی مورد اول

                دیدگاه


                  #9
                  پاسخ : مدار گیرنده ریموت کد لرن

                  نوشته اصلی توسط masoud.gha
                  از بس دنبال مدار گیرنده کد لرن و تکنیک کار اون گشتم وپیدا نکردم دیگه خسته شدم . نمیدونم چرا خودمون رو با این کد فیکس سر کار گذاشتیم . بیاین یکم از داشته هامون رو با همدیگه قسمت کنیم ، تو هر سایتی میرم همه انگار دارن اطلاعات همو کپی میکنن. تنها یک نفر پروژه آماده اونو داره که میفروشه . من دنبال آماده نیستم . میخام یاد بگیرم . حالا دوستان یک زحمت بکشن این بحثو کامل کنیم که هم یاد بگیریم و هم یاد بدیم .
                  یکی از دوستان پروژه کاملش رو توی لینک زیر گذاشته . پولی نیست فقط دعاش کنید

                  گیرنده کد لرنینگ
                  باز هم عید آمد و ما لختیم...

                  دیدگاه

                  لطفا صبر کنید...
                  X